Warning: error_log(/data/www/wwwroot/hmttv.cn/caches/error_log.php): failed to open stream: Permission denied in /data/www/wwwroot/hmttv.cn/phpcms/libs/functions/global.func.php on line 537 Warning: error_log(/data/www/wwwroot/hmttv.cn/caches/error_log.php): failed to open stream: Permission denied in /data/www/wwwroot/hmttv.cn/phpcms/libs/functions/global.func.php on line 537
班每天都避免不了在網上查閱一些資料和內容,遇到有用的想要復制下來,可是有些網站總是限制復制怎么辦?電腦大神教你5秒破解,以后遇到這種情況輕松復制,快快學起來吧!
其實正式利用JavaScript代碼實現(xiàn)禁止復制的,"解鈴還須系鈴人",既然可以用JS特性禁止,那自然也可以用JS實現(xiàn),那我們先看第一種方法:
在瀏覽器地址欄中輸入: javascript:void($={}); 然后按回車鍵,然后網頁上的內容就任由你復制啦,注意要手動輸入,復制無效哦。
首先我們將網頁保存為HTML文件,然后打開這個文件,就可以自由復制啦,一般瀏覽器都支持【保存網頁】功能。
將需要復制的文字截圖,然后用文字識別工具識別圖片中的文字,再手動將文字復制到文檔中即可。
文字識別網址:http://app.xunjiepdf.com/ocrpart)
有了以上幾種方法嗎,以后在遇到網站上的文章無法復制再也不用怕啦,快快收藏起來吧!
段子手168
方法一:代碼破解法
打開你需要復制內容的網頁,在瀏覽器地址欄輸入“javascript:void($={});”這串代碼,
然后按下回車鍵,這時候就允許你復制文本了。
方法 二:打印網頁法
我們還可以利用打印網頁的時候,在預覽頁面將文本復制下來。按下快捷鍵【Ctrl+P】,
將會進入打印界面,直接在右側的預覽界面,選中文本進行復制。
方法三:后臺控制端
打開網頁后,按下功能鍵【F12】,進入網頁后臺找到【Console】,
在下面輸入這串符號“$=0”,再2按下回車鍵,
網頁文字就能自由復制了。
方法四:查看源代碼
你還可以在網頁空白處,右擊選擇【查看頁面源代碼】,然后一直向下滑動,找到密密麻麻的文本,
選中直接復制提取出來。
方法五:保存本地網頁
打開網頁鼠標右擊,選擇【網頁另存為】,然后在彈出的窗口中,
將保存類型改為【網頁,僅HTML】,接著點擊【保存】。
關閉當前網頁,回到桌面找到剛剛保存的本地網頁文件,雙擊打開后,就可以隨意復制啦。
方法六:截圖識別文字
此外,我們還可以利用OCR文字識別技術,將網頁文字識別出來。
需要借助掌上識別王工具,找到【文字識別】-【快速截圖識別】功能。
方法七:
網址最前面加上 read: (用 Microsoft Edge 瀏覽器打開)
方法八:
1)按 F12 打開調試框,點擊右上角【設置】。
2)往下拉,找到 【Debugger】
3)勾選 【Disable JavaScript】
4)返回頁面,按 F5 刷新一下頁面,這樣網頁文字就可以復制了。
然,我可以幫助您設計這個插件。由于我無法直接編寫代碼并測試它,我將提供您所需的代碼和步驟,您可以按照這些指導自己創(chuàng)建這個插件。
### 插件文件結構
您的插件將包含以下文件:
1. `manifest.json` - 插件的配置文件。
2. `background.js` - 后臺腳本,用于執(zhí)行復制操作。
3. `popup.html` - (可選)點擊插件時顯示的小彈窗。
### 步驟1: 創(chuàng)建 `manifest.json`
在一個新文件夾中創(chuàng)建一個名為 `manifest.json` 的文件,內容如下:
```json
{
"manifest_version": 2,
"name": "Copy URL",
"version": "1.0",
"description": "Copy the current page URL to clipboard",
"permissions": ["activeTab", "clipboardWrite"],
"background": {
"scripts": ["background.js"],
"persistent": false
},
"browser_action": {
"default_title": "Copy URL"
}
}
```
### 步驟2: 創(chuàng)建 `background.js`
然后,創(chuàng)建一個名為 `background.js` 的文件,內容如下:
```javascript
chrome.browserAction.onClicked.addListener(function(tab) {
var url = tab.url;
var input = document.createElement('input');
document.body.appendChild(input);
input.value = url;
input.select();
document.execCommand('copy');
document.body.removeChild(input);
});
```
### 步驟3: (可選)創(chuàng)建 `popup.html`
如果您想要一個點擊插件時顯示的小彈窗,可以創(chuàng)建 `popup.html`。但對于您的需求,這不是必須的。
### 步驟4: 測試插件
1. 打開 Chrome 瀏覽器。
2. 訪問 `chrome://extensions/`。
3. 啟用右上角的 "開發(fā)者模式"。
4. 點擊 "加載已解壓的擴展程序",選擇包含您的文件的文件夾。
現(xiàn)在,您應該可以在瀏覽器工具欄看到您的插件圖標。點擊它時,當前頁面的URL應該被復制到剪貼板。
這個插件非常基礎,沒有錯誤處理或者額外的用戶界面元素。您可以根據(jù)需要進一步開發(fā)和完善它。
*請認真填寫需求信息,我們會在24小時內與您取得聯(lián)系。